If im not mistaken, on old haven there was a limit in how much your exploration affected discovery of random items, and there was no point on increasing exploration beyond that since it wasnt going to make more items appear on your radar. I know that some craft uses exploration, but right now im just concerned on discovery on my hunter/gatherer character.

So, is it still the same as old haven?, is there a point in exploration where its enough to discover every forageable item? or does higher exploration stat affects your chances of triggering rares on your radar?

Exploration is not really worth it.
If you want to see ALL scents I'd recommend rising exp as much as you can.

But for foraging something like 40-60 is probably enough.

Assuming you also have some perception.

Exploration is best if you're the dedicated explorer of your group. It's best to level up early on as an investment.

Otherwise it kinda sucks compared to survival. Survival is overall way more useful and you can craft curios with common materials rather than searching the map

Plus raising perception does the exact same thing as exploration. The only attribute that goes with survival crafting is psych which is the hardest stat to get
